    Clay's is... that local place. Kids work here. (They're kids to me, dammit). It reminds of the "first job" a lot of people get. The food isn't fine dining, but it's *good food.* They have ice cream. They make pizza (and while the crust is okay, the pizzas as a whole are pretty awesome). I've gotten ice cream, pizza, random sandwiches l, BLT, etc etc. it's... simple. Classic. Timeless even. It's not five-star dining and it doesn't need to be. It's just simple, good, food.

    We chose this spot because it was on the way to our campsite for the night. We travel often and like to find the local spots when we get a little peckish. I saw this spot on Google Maps with all the reviews and was like, "Well okay! Let's do it!". Turns out, it's an adorable little cafe/diner with a long history and excellent selections and staff! It's a bit unassuming when you see the sign from the roadway. I was a little thrown off, but the cafe is in the parking lot to the back (so says the sign!). There's plenty of parking, and in the time it took me to get parked and changed into something more restaurant-friendly (driving long hours), several people had pulled up and left with pick up orders! Which boded well! Upon entry, the decor is a little stark with it's bright eye-devouring grandmother's kitchen yellow but the walls to the right (in the direction of the bathroom) are covered with stories and notes and wonderful photos of the journey the restaurant had taken. Fun reads. Good info. Otherwise, the front counter is super bare, making it feel like a long forgotten crossroad diner somewhere in the desert, but once you turn the corner it opens up into a pretty large open floor plan with red and white decor reminiscent of the Coke bottle fad someone's grandmother obsessed over. We were seated by a server who looked to be in high school and I only remark on this because throughout our stay it started to make more sense. Put a pin in that. We ordered the cheese sticks to start and they were the kind of cheese stick without the panko breading -- served with "pizza sauce". Not the best cheese sticks I've ever had, but it didn't really matter because it was cheese and I had a need. We got the shredded chicken sandwich with fries, a taco salad, and the three-cheese quesadilla. All of it was exactly what you would expect out of a concession stand-like kind of situation of food/traditional diner fare, but I ain't subtracting stars for that because we knew what we were getting into. They did that level of food and did it very well. The lettuce in my taco salad was crisp and not wilty and weird. The shredded chicken threw us off a little on taste over time, but hey, it's shredded chicken. Essentially -- the food is actually better than you would expect it to be for a neighborhood cafe, and that's good enough for me. We found after exploring the town a bit more that the high school student theme rang true throughout the town, which, pulling the pin out, made this diner even more adorable and homey and sweet. The small town idea seems to be living true here and this diner is a great way to get your bearings when traveling through or just grab a quick and easy meal.
